Limber Pine
About Limber Pine
Limber Pine Campground is south of Red Lodge, along the banks of the Main Fork of Rock Creek. It is near the base of the switchbacks of the Beartooth Scenic Highway. Mount Maurice Trail (#6), Corral Creek Trail (#9), Bear Track Trail (#8), Lake Fork Trail (#2), Parkside National Recreation Trail (#103), Hell Roaring Plateau Trail (#11), Glacier Lake Trail (#3), Sheridan Campground, Rattin Campground, Parkside Campground, Greenough Lake Campground, and M-K Campground are also located in the Main Fork Rock Creek drainage. There is a 16 day maximum stay on all Beartooth Ranger District campgrounds. Camp sites: 13Host: Yes at Parkside CG Max Trailer Length: 45ftAccessible Facilities: Toilet and 2 campsites. Trash Pickup: Bear resistant dumpsters centrally located at the beginning of the Greenough Lake CG road Firewood: $5.00 / bundle. Don't move firewood to other areas or bring in outside firewood. Prevent the spread of tree-killing insects by obtaining firewood near your destination or purchasing it from the campground host.
Details
Fees: Overnight Use: Single Site: $20 per night (includes 1 driving vehicle) Additional Vehicle Fee: $10 per additional vehicle Campground Day Use (over an hour): $6 per day
